Carolina Maria Stark is a judge for the Milwaukee County Circuit Court in Wisconsin. She was elected to her position on April 3, 2012. [1]
2012 election
Stark ran successfully, defeating third-time candidate Christopher Lipscomb in the February 21st primary and unseating incumbent Nelson Phillips in the April 3rd election.[1][2][3][2][4]

Education
Stark received her Bachelor of Arts in Criminal Justice and Spanish from St. Louis University and received her Juris Doctorate from the University of Wisconsin Law School.[2]
Career
Up until her election to the Milwaukee County Circuit Court in 2012, Stark served as an Administrative Law Judge for the State of Wisconsin Department of Workforce Development. She is also the Vice Chair of the Milwaukee Fire and Police Commission. Previously she worked as a trial attorney with Stark Law Office, LLC and the Milwaukee-based Centro Legal Por Derechos Humanos and Esperanza Unida.[2]
